Frequently Asked Questions

What specific local zoning or land use issues in Maplewood, OH should I discuss with a real estate attorney before buying a property?

A Maplewood real estate attorney can advise on local zoning ordinances, which may regulate property use, accessory dwelling units (ADUs), or home-based businesses. They can also check for any specific village-level property maintenance codes or historic district regulations that could affect your renovation plans or property value.

How can a Maplewood, OH real estate attorney help with issues related to Ohio's unique property disclosure laws?

Ohio law requires sellers to complete a detailed residential property disclosure form. A local attorney can review this form for accuracy, advise on your liability as a seller, or help a buyer understand the implications of any disclosed defects, such as foundation issues common in the region, and negotiate repairs or price adjustments.

When is a real estate attorney required for a transaction in Maplewood, Ohio, versus when is it just recommended?

While Ohio does not legally require an attorney for standard residential closings, it is highly recommended in Maplewood for complex transactions like buying a short sale, dealing with probate or estate property, or purchasing commercial real estate. An attorney is crucial for drafting or reviewing unique contract addendums specific to your situation.

What are common fee structures for real estate attorneys in Maplewood, and what should a typical residential closing cost?

Most Maplewood attorneys charge a flat fee for residential transactions, typically ranging from $500 to $1,500, depending on complexity. This fee generally covers contract review, title examination, preparing closing documents, and attending the settlement. Always request a detailed engagement letter outlining the services included.

Can a Maplewood real estate attorney assist with title issues specific to older properties in the area?

Yes, this is a key service. Attorneys in Maplewood often handle title searches to uncover potential problems like old easements, boundary disputes with neighboring properties, or unresolved liens from local contractors. They can then work to clear these issues or secure title insurance to protect your investment.

Finding the Right Property Dispute Lawyer in Maplewood, Ohio: A Local Guide

If you’re searching for 'property dispute lawyers near me' in Maplewood, Ohio, you’re likely facing a stressful situation involving your most valuable asset. Whether it’s a disagreement over a fence line, a dispute with a neighbor about tree encroachment, or a complex issue arising from a local real estate transaction, having the right legal counsel familiar with our community is crucial. This guide will help you understand the local landscape and find effective representation.

Property disputes in Maplewood often have unique local characteristics. Our town’s mix of historic homes, newer subdivisions, and rural acreage means disputes can range from interpreting old, vague property descriptions in deeds to enforcing modern homeowners' association (HOA) covenants in planned communities like The Woods of Maplewood. A lawyer familiar with Montgomery County’s Recorder’s Office and the specific zoning ordinances of Maplewood Township can navigate these systems far more efficiently than a general practitioner from a larger city.

Common scenarios we see locally include boundary line disagreements, especially on larger, irregularly shaped lots common in the eastern parts of town. Disputes over shared driveways or easements for utilities are another frequent issue. Furthermore, with Maplewood’s ongoing growth, construction disputes—where a new build allegedly encroaches on a neighbor’s land or violates setback rules—are increasingly common. A local attorney will understand the nuances of how the Maplewood Zoning Board of Appeals typically rules on such matters.

When looking for a property dispute lawyer here, prioritize local experience. Start by checking with the Montgomery County Bar Association for referrals to attorneys who specialize in real estate law. Look for firms with offices in nearby Englewood, Vandalia, or Dayton that actively serve Maplewood clients. During your initial consultation, ask specific questions: How many boundary line disputes have you handled in Montgomery County? Are you familiar with the surveyors local judges tend to respect? Have you appeared before the Maplewood Township trustees on variance issues?

Practical first steps you can take include gathering all your documents—your deed, any surveys, photographs of the issue, and correspondence with the other party. Avoid making aggressive changes to the property (like cutting down a disputed tree) before seeking legal advice, as this can weaken your position. Mediation is often a successful and cost-effective first step, and many local lawyers are skilled in this alternative dispute resolution process, which can preserve neighborly relations—something especially valuable in a close-knit community like ours.

Resolving a property dispute requires a clear understanding of both Ohio law and local practice. By choosing a lawyer who knows Maplewood’s specific landscape, from its property records to its courtrooms, you significantly increase your chances of a favorable and efficient resolution, allowing you to restore peace and protect your investment in our community.
